Meetings are held either in the Resource Room close to the Observatory (RR), or in the Science Lab in the school (SL). Rooms open at 7:30pm and talks start at 8:00 sharp.

Observing sessions

  • Held at the Piazzi Smyth Observatory on every CLEAR Wednesday between October and April - unless otherwise stated
  • Everyone is welcome to attend and members of BAS will be on hand to answer any questions
  • All times are as per current clock settings (UT in Winter, BST in Summer)
  • Observing will take place regardless of the moon phase
  • Observing will also take place on Committee nights
  • There is generally no observing on members evenings (last Wednesday of the month), unless otherwise noted
  • Dark Site Observing is held at Daisy Banks Picnic Site - see here for a map to get there
